1876-CC Dime, Uncirculated Details
Newly Discovered Fortin Variety

1876-CC 10C -- Artificial Toning -- NGC Details. Unc. Fortin-Unlisted. This Uncirculated CC coin displays ice-blue, violet, and orange patina on the obverse with lavender and golden-tan elements on the reverse. NGC notes that the toning is of questionable origin, but that fails to diminish the appeal of this sharply defined, lustrous example.

Variety: This new die marriage show's Fortin's Obverse 22 paired with Reverse Q. Obverse 22 is the only obverse die that appears to be an exact match for date placement, and there are no diagnostic markers indicating the obverse is from a different die. Reverse Q is an exact match by both mintmark placement and the presence of faint die lines in the field just to the right of the right-hand ribbon loop.

Heritage Commentary: With a large mintage totaling more than 8.2 million coins, it is unsurprising that so many die pairs have been identified to date. The search for new varieties is ongoing, however, and Fortin notes on his website: "Research of this date and mintmark needs to continue as I do expect additional die pairings to be located by knowledgeable dealers and collectors."
